titleOfInvention |
Isoxazolo-quinazolines as regulators of protein kinase activity |
abstract |
The present invention relates to substituted isoxazolo-quinazolines that modulate the activity of protein kinases and are therefore useful for treating dysregulated protein kinase activity, particularly diseases caused by human MPS1 and PERK. The present invention also provides methods for preparing these compounds, pharmaceutical compositions containing these compounds, and methods for treating diseases using these compounds or pharmaceutical compositions containing these compounds. . |
